Speed Range

One of the most important factors when purchasing a treadmill is the speed range. If you plan to run or jog, you'll require a treadmill that can handle higher speeds. If you're only walking, a slower speed range may be sufficient.

Also, pay attention to the maximum incline percentage the treadmill can climb. You can increase the intensity of your workout by increasing the angle. This will help you burn more fat.

Incline Percentage

Add incline to treadmills for different workouts. For example, walking at a one-percent incline is different from walking at an incline of 3 percent. Running at an incline can be more strenuous than walking, burning more calories.

Treadmills come with a variety of incline levels to choose from, which vary depending on the fitness level and goals of each user. In general, the majority of experts recommend starting with a low gradient of about 2 percent and gradually increasing it as your body becomes more accustomed to the exercise.

Many treadmills display the incline setting in percentages, which means that every unit of distance you travel on the belt is increased by the same amount. A 10% incline simulates running uphill, which intensifies the workout. This requires a different set of muscles as compared to running on flat ground.

Some treadmills have an even steeper slope. Some models with higher-end features can have as much as a 15 percent incline. While it's not recommended to run on this steep slope certain endurance runners like those who compete in the Mount Washington Road Race do it due to the extra intensity it provides their muscles and bodies.
